Chipper Lands on DL for First Time This Season
Braves placed third baseman Chipper Jones on the 15-day disabled list a strained left hamstring. Tim Hudson is joining him. By placing both on the disabled list, the Braves could be waving the white flag on their season, making a Mark Teixeira trade more likely. Omar Infante and Martin Prado will fill in at third base for the next couple of weeks. The move for Jones will likely be retroactive to July 24, so he could return in early August if things go according to plan. He has played in 89 of 103 games this season, but hasn’t played in more than 137 games since the start of the 2004. (Rotoworld, CBS Sports)
